HC Deb 23 February 1993 vol 219 c539W
Mr. Madden

To ask the Secretary of State for Health what policy advice or guidelines she has issued concerning the treatment of those suffering from mental illness in secure units; and if she will make a statement.

Mr. Yeo

The treatment of mental illness is the responsibility of the professionals involved. The code of practice issued under the Mental Health Act 1983 provides guidance on the operation of that Act. Current needs for treatment in secure conditions are among the issues considered in the reports of the joint Department of Health/Home Office review of services for mentally disordered offenders (Cm. 2088, 1992). In the light of the review's recommendations we have increased capital funding for medium secure services from £3 million in 1991–92 to £17 million in 1992–93 and £22.4 million in 1993–94.
